Once you expand how do you defend your territories?
I haven't expanded very much, but I'm just wondering if the AI actually attacks your outposts as you expand out, and if so, what do you do? The map is massive and I'm not sure how you could get from one side of it to the other to help defend an area if it came under attack

Tanvaras 25 maja 2017 o 18:40 
Research and upgrade your outposts to stronger versions this helps a lot against the AI attempting to take them back.

Where possible always go and assist any regions being attacked by AI.

I myself have some smaller fleets also at certain strategic areas to help support hostile take overs.

Probably the first major thing to do when starting out is "Do Not" over extend yourself to much or you will feel the pain. Start out slow, build up your forces and then push out on conquest.

But HOW you build a T Gate?
The cyborg dude said that to me but I see the option nowhere
Evangelion 29 maja 2017 o 13:06 
Research something called Hyperspace Torrent Module or something like that, and then use civilian fleets on wormhole and/or inactive T-Gates to make them.
